Conserved binding mode but diverse interfaces of MreC‐PBP2 interactions
The crystal structure of abMreC reveals a conserved two β‐barrel architecture and provides structural insights into its role within the bacterial elongasome. The abMreC–abPBP2 complex model identifies the molecular basis of MreC‐mediated PBP2 recognition, contributing to the regulation of peptidoglycan synthesis.

Microbiome‐blood–brain barrier interactions in aging — mechanisms and therapeutic potential
Aging reshapes the gut microbiome (↓SCFA‐producing commensals; ↑pro‐inflammatory outputs), shifting circulating metabolites (↓SCFAs; ↑LPS, ↑TMAO, ↑PAA) that act at the BBB to increase nonspecific transcytosis, alter transport, and promote astrocyte reactivity, heightening brain vulnerability.

NCI-MATCH Trial Draws Strong Interest [PDF]
Abstract After 800 cancer patients enrolled during the first 3 months of the NCI-MATCH trial, organizers have extended a temporary halt in enrollment to gear up for the next phase. The basket study, which matches patients to approved or experimental drugs based on specific genetic mutations in their tumors, is expected to resume in April
